Effects of Spray Distance on the Microstructure and Thermal Cycling Behavior Of PS-PVD (Gd <sub>0.9</sub>Yb <sub>0.1</sub>) <sub>2</sub>Zr <sub>2</sub>O <sub>7</sub>/YSZ <sup>2 Thermal Barrier Coatings</sup>

In this study, (Gd0.9Yb0.1)2Zr2O7 (GYbZ)/yttria-stabilized zirconia (YSZ) double-ceramic-layer (DCL) thermal barrier coatings (TBCs) were prepared by plasma spray–physical vapor deposition (PS-PVD). The microstructure, mechanical performance and thermal cycling behavior of coatings prepared with spraying distances of 600, 800 and 1000 mm were investigated. The GYbZ coating prepared with a spraying distance of 600 mm showed a closely packed columnar structure. However, the GYbZ coatings prepared with spraying distances of 800 and 1000 mm showed a quasi-columnar structure. The GYbZ coating prepared with a spraying distance of 800 mm has the thickest columnar crystals with obvious inter-columnar gaps. In addition, this coating exhibited excellent mechanical performance and the best thermal shock resistance. The primary failure patterns appearing during thermal cycling on the surface of TBCs can be classified into the following five types: caves, exfoliation, delamination cracks, spalled areas and radiate cracks. Furthermore, the failure behavior of these coatings in water-quenching tests is clarified.
